why isnt there a GameBoy ADVANCE Emulator. there is one for pocketpc that does all gameboy games, nintendo, super nintendo, sega game gear, sega master system and nec turbo grafx-16.(website morph gear) (http://www.morphgear.com/)
and the web site says the stats of each system heres a gameboy advance and super nintendo:
Nintendo GameBoy Advance
32-bit ARM7TDMI 16.7 Mhz
240x160 resolution
511 or 32,768 of 65,535 colors
Super Nintendo Entertainment System
16-bit 65816 2.68 or 3.58 Mhz
256x224 resolution or 512x448 max
56 of 32,768 colors
I mean a sony clie out performs these stats and a emulator should work. I know there is more than one standard old grayscale gameboy emulator (Liberty) but they dont do gameboy advance.
